Another Downed Database I wanted to let everyone know that my (un)archived, no cold backup database is now up!!  I took Oracle's advice and started with the full physical backup and did not apply the differential backup.  I then entered Recover Database and when the messsage came back 'database recovered' I just stood there and stared at the screen.  When I finally started breathing because I was turning blue, I opened the database, and it opened!  I couldn't believe it after all the things I've read.  Although I did lose one week's worth of data, in this case it is something we can live with.  Needless to say I am going to put it in archivelog mode ASAP.  Oh, and I did curve the urge to let everyone know until I shut the database back down and got a good backup (as one of the respondees had suggested). Many thanks to all who replied.  Whether the suggestions helped or not it is always nice to know that someone knows what you're going through and are trying to help.
